If you scroll down to the footer, you’ll see a row with two colums (50/50), which have a background image.
Whatever I try, can’t get the background image to show full width? (with keeping my content within the main container). I’m using Swift Modern theme.

    Hi Jverburgt

    Have you made progress with this challenge? Editing the row in question, clicking Layout tab on the right and then setting Row Layout to Full Width, not Full Width Stretched. That should do the trick.
